OpenImageIO: A Comprehensive Overview

OpenImageIO (OIIO) is an open-source library designed for reading, writing, and manipulating images. It is widely utilized in the fields of computer graphics, visual effects, and image processing. With its robust set of features, OpenImageIO has become a staple in the workflows of many artists and developers.

History

OpenImageIO was developed by the team at Sony Pictures Imageworks and has been in active development since its inception in the early 2010s. Initially created to support the visual effects and animation pipeline at Imageworks, it has since grown into a collaborative open-source project with contributions from developers worldwide. The project has gained recognition for its robustness and flexibility, becoming a go-to solution for image processing needs across various industries.
